From the Rutland Herald December 10, 2009
Ellis D. Winslow

BENNINGTON - Ellis D. "Ellie" Winslow, 93, died Dec. 7, 2009, at his residence, following a brief illness.

He was born in Bennington June 26, 1916, the son of Edward and Annette (Griffis) Winslow.

He was a 1934 graduate of Bennington High School.

Mr. Winslow was a veteran of World War II, serving in the Western Pacific and the Philippines. He received the Asiatic Pacific Campaign Ribbon, Victory Medal and Good Conduct Medal.

He married the former Ann F. O'Toole June 19, 1937, in Bennington.

In earlier years, he was employed at Fillmore Farms. In 1939, he went to work as a district agent for Prudential Insurance Co., retiring in 1976.

Mr. Winslow served as foreman and treasurer of Putnam Hose Fire Department. He also served on the Selective Service Board, the Board of Civil Authority and was a justice of the peace. He was a member of Knights of Columbus Council 307, Bennington Lodge of Elks 567, Sacred Heart St. Francis de Sales Church and the Bennington Club.

He enjoyed hunting and fishing, winters in Florida playing golf and travel to Canada.

Survivors include his wife and two daughters, Joan Foster and Carol Harbour, all of Bennington; four grandchildren, eight great-grandchildren; many nieces, nephews and cousins.

He was predeceased by a sister, Marian Davis, and five brothers, Duane, Edward, Carleton, Bernard and Richard Winslow.

The funeral service will be held at 2 p.m. Friday, Dec. 11, at the Mahar and Son Funeral Home where friends may call from noon prior to the service.

Burial with military honors will take place in Park Lawn Cemetery.
